Having been with Plusnet some years and receiving a minimum of 2mb and a d/load speed of 17-1800kbps I'm now told that I can only expect HALF this rate. >:(.My speed has been up and down since last november,always steady before then
.BT Test today...... Download speed achieved during the test was - 912 Kbps
For your connection, the acceptable range of speeds is 200-1000 Kbps.
Additional Information:
Your DSL Connection Rate :1856 Kbps(DOWN-STREAM), 448 Kbps(UP-STREAM)
IP Profile for your line is - 1000 Kbps
Reply from CS after further tests....
As per our conversation, The line tests have completed and are showing your connection to the exchange (known as sync) is set at a normal rate for your line based on your line attenutation and exchange determined maximum stable rate. Unfortunately It would appear your line is either very long or of poor quality and most likely wont support higher speeds that what you are currently getting. It may be possible that you were getting better speeds in the past however it can be common with poor lines that they can degrade further naturally or it may be that a different internet provider such as an LLU service were able to offer slightly higher speeds
So the latest theory is that my line (not my neighbours)has deteriorated over the past few months.

Thanks for that. Your sync speed increased from 1856 to 2560 which will double your profile from 1000 to 2000 after a 24 - 72 hour stable connection. This suggests that something you unplugged / swapped out was putting some interference down the line. If you plug each device back in one by one and monitor the line, you may notice that the circuit drops when a particular device is returned. You might want to try double-filtering that device, or just leave it unplugged. The filter may also have been the cause of the problem, a process of elimination will let you know if this is the case.
